UPMSP Class 10, Class 12 Results: The Uttar Pradesh Madhyamik Shiksha Parishad (UPMSP) is likely to announce the UP Board Class 10 and Class 12 Results in the month of June. According to the most recent information, the evaluation of more than 2.25 crore answer sheets from Class 10 and Class 12 examinees from 2022. This year, the Board instructed the chief head examiners and examiners to grant equal marks to all examinees for questions asked outside the curriculum in approximately a dozen topics in Class 12 and seven key courses in Class 10. For the convenience of the candidates, we have mentioned the steps via which the candidates can check the results:

  1. Go to the official result website – upmsp.edu.in
  2. On the homepage, click on the ‘UPMSP UP Board result’ link.
  3. Fill in the required credentials.
  4. Submit the details
  5. Download the results and take a printout for future reference.

Here are some of the other important details:

  • UP Board Class 10 board examinations were held from March 24 to April 13
  • Class 12 board exams were held from March 24 to April 13
  • There were a total of 51,92,689 students that enrolled, but only 47,75,749 of them showed up for the tests.
  • UPMSP Class 10th and 12th results 2022 will be available on upresults.nic.in and upmsp.edu.in once they are announced.

What Candidates Can Expect (Bonus Marks)

  • Students are expected to receive bonus marks on the Class 12 Maths exam.
  • The candidates are likely to receive 10 bonus marks in paper code 329FP, seven bonus marks in 324FF, three bonus marks in 324FH, five bonus marks in 324FI, and four bonus marks in 324ZB.
  • Students are expected to receive bonus marks on the Class 12 Hindi exam.
  • They will get one extra mark in paper code 301 DL, five bonus marks in 302 DP and five marks in 302 DR.
  • Students will receive nine marks in the Class 10 Social Science paper number 825BY, six marks in 825CA, and four marks as a bonus in 825CD.
